Filed by Spotify under ambient, krautrock and art rock, Brian Eno has built a streaming catalogue deep enough to make the top ten a genuine question. With 500 tracks tracked on Spotify, there is a lot of catalogue to sort through before the top ten falls out. 890K people follow Brian Eno on Spotify.
Add up Brian Eno's top ten and you get 512 million plays on Spotify. Number one alone accounts for 123 million of those plays. First to tenth spans only about 4.2x, so the back half of the list is genuinely competitive. These are solid rather than stadium-scale numbers, which tends to make the ordering harder to guess. Last place on the list comes in at 29 million streams, out of 500 tracks tracked in total. That is the line you need to find to complete it.
| # | Song | Streams |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| An Ending (Ascent) - Remastered 2005 | 122,629,957 |
| 2 | Emerald and Stone | 85,102,936 |
| 3 | Signals - Remastered 2005 | 73,956,435 |
| 4 | Stars - Remastered 2005 | 49,131,982 |
| 5 | Drift - Remastered 2005 | 31,255,328 |
| 6 | Complex Heaven | 31,144,138 |
| 7 | 2/1 - Remastered 2004 | 30,418,418 |
| 8 | Miss Sarajevo | 30,034,534 |
| 9 | 1/1 - Remastered 2004 | 29,639,498 |
| 10 | Strange Overtones | 29,163,495 |
